## Blue-Green Cutover — Ledgerline Billing Worker

1. Deploy green stack; wait for queue drain on blue.
2. Run reconciliation smoke test against green.
3. Flip router weight 0→100 in one step.
4. Keep blue warm for 30 minutes.

Before flipping, sign the cutover manifest with the deploy key below.

signing key of bagap-yawep = bky13_TbfT6ZMUoGJo2

Symptom: users are logged out roughly every ten minutes despite active sessions. Cause: the refresh worker compares token expiry using the issuing node's clock, so clock skew between nodes causes premature invalidation. Before touching anything, confirm skew by checking the drift metric on the affected pool. Do not restart the whole auth tier — restart only the refresh worker after verifying the fix flag is enabled. Confirm the running worker matches the expected configuration values below.

settings of tagef-bawif:
DRUIX_HOST=druix.zemvarlabs.internal
DRUIX_PORT=8000

Quarterly Planning Note — Divestiture of the Coastal Tooling Unit

For the finance team: the sale of the Coastal Tooling unit to Pellmark Industries remains on track for close in Q3. Please finalize the carve-out balance sheet, reconcile intercompany positions, and prepare the working-capital adjustment schedule by month-end. Audit support requests should be prioritized. For planning purposes, note the following sensitive item:

internal memo for hawef-kahif: The finance team signed off on a budget of $25.9 million for Project Sorox. The renewal with Pelokek Logistics closes at $51.7 million a year, 52 percent below the last contract.

## Changelog — Brindlewick API v4.2

Default pagination for all public list endpoints has changed from offset-based to cursor-based. The default page size drops from 100 to 25, and the `limit` cap is now enforced server-side. Plugin authors relying on `page` parameters should migrate to `cursor` tokens before the deprecation window closes. The new defaults applied to production are as follows.

service settings:
[oliix]
team = noveth
access_code = ac_4de949
host = oliix.novachq.corp
port = 8080
owner = wenir.casion
peer = wenys.lumicstack.corp